Disclaimer: This site does not store any files on its server.

Watch Better Barbie Better World

Better Barbie Better World is a video starring Isadora Flynn, Loretta Flynn, and Ryan Flynn. On a trip to a big box store, an eco-anxiety filled father surprises his daughters with a mission to place his new inspirational toy doll...

Documentary, Comedy, Family
Ryan Flynn
Isadora Flynn, Loretta Flynn, Ryan Flynn

All Systems Operational

Top reviews

Write a review